How Do You Know A Number Is Rational?

A number is rational if it can be expressed as a fraction p/q, where p and q are integers and q is not equal to zero.

What Are 5 Examples Of Irrational Numbers?
5 examples of irrational numbers are: pi, e, the square root of 2, the square root of 3, and the square root of 5.
